After the 2045 B.S earthquake that time government felt that they require their own Building Code. Due to the lack of country code mostly engineers are forced to use other country building codes. Without considering the strength of materials people are constructing residential buildings. 10-15 years ago, about 95% of the building’s structures are built-up without taking the suggestion of any technicians or engineers. Even technicians do not have proper knowledge and idea about earthquake residential buildings.

    Implementation of NBC Codes

    From 2060/04/12, NBC is started to use in government and government shared construction buildings. Later in 2062/11/01 after the publish of Gadget NBC is implemented in 58 municipalities, 28 VDC where district headquarter lies at that time.

    Before releasing it on government gadget to implement the NBC is started to use in Lalitpur metropolitan in 2059 B.S Magh-2 on the occasion of National Earthquake day.

    NBC Codes: Nepal National Building Code

    National Building Code (NBC) is a group of 23 codes. At first 20 codes are developed after that 3 codes, architectural code, electrical, and sanitation are added to NBC in 2060 B.S.

    National Building Code(NBC) are sub categorized into 4 types:

    1. International state-of-Art (SOA):

    By using reference from the developed country building code you can design a building. Generally, while constructing important buildings, commercial buildings, stadium reference is taken from developed country code. It contains only one code.

    2. Professionally Engineered Buildings (PEB):

    Buildings having a plinth area of more than 1000 square feet or a structural span greater than 4.5-meter are categorized in Professionally Engineered Buildings (PEB). These buildings should be designed and built-in with guidelines of engineers.

    3. Mandatory Rule of Thumb (MRT)

    The main objective of these Mandatory Rules of Thumb (MRT) is to provide ready-to-use dimensions and details for various structural and non-structural elements for up to three-storey reinforced concrete (RC), framed, ordinary residential buildings commonly being built by owner-builders in Nepal. Their purpose is to replace the non-engineered construction presently adopted with pre-engineered construction. Now, it is mandatory to follow MRT while designing or constructing buildings in every municipality of Nepal.

    4. Guidelines for Remote Rural Buildings (GRB)

    Guidelines for Remote Rural Buildings (GRB) guidelines are prepared in order to raise the seismic safety of low-strength masonry buildings and earthen buildings. These guidelines are intended to be implemented by the owner/builder with some assistance from the technicians.
